About this arrangement

Piano Solo - Level 3 - Digital Download SKU: A0.981415 Composed by Maria E. Goelz. 20th Century. Score. 3 pages. Maria E Shemer #4716285. Published by Maria E Shemer (A0.981415). A piano solo inspired by the warm days in February of 2019. . This product was created by a member of ArrangeMe, Hal Leonard’s global self-publishing community of independent composers, arrangers, and songwriters. ArrangeMe allows for the publication of unique arrangements of both popular titles and original compositions from a wide variety of voices and backgrounds.
